Amy B.

Located right next door to North Shore Poke Co, this coffee shop focuses on top-quality coffees and lattes along with a great collection of coffee-related items for at-home use, including a coffee maker and coffee filters from Japan. The matcha latte with almond milk was super tasty and the matcha was most likely really good stuff from Japan. The staff are super friendly and helpful, and we even discussed parking options in the area. The ambiance is very bright and inviting, as well as well-designed and clean. It's a great place to grab a drink after some world-class poke next door.

Joyce Y.

Popped in before the surfing competition today, expecting nothing and left with not one, but two drinks! Yum! The menu is simple, but with exactly what I love- lavender, so I ordered a matcha iced with lavender, but an iced coffee with lavender came out. I didn't mind, so I wasn't going to say anything, but the barista corrected herself immediately, and I got to sip and try both drinks. The baristas were all friendly and warm. The store itself is small and cozy, but the ambiance is great! Definitely will stop by again if I'm ever in the area. 4 stars for the initial drink mistake, no public restroom, and the matcha being pre-made.

I've started dabbling in the art of coffee making with my own espresso machine. One of the most…read moreimportant things I've learned is that procuring the best beans is more than half the battle. While researching roasters in the south OC area, I found Mameya in Laguna Niguel. I instantly feel in love with their concept of "blending Japanese tradition and innovation to create a coffee experience that transcends the ordinary." They specialize in offering beans from all over the world and roast them to your personal preference. Being able to pick your beans and roast level is simply amazing. This allows the fresh taste and small batches for experimenting. The quality is so remarkable and their online ordering system is great for timing each new batch for ease of pickup. If you are looking for a new coffee experience that specializes in quality coffee for rememberable consumption, Mameya has you covered!
